By Ichioka Shiun, Meiji Period
Cast in relief to depict the smooth ripples of a river formed by a pair of carp swimming just beneath the surface; signed with chiselled signature Shiun saku, with wood stand; with tomobako titled and signed by the artist Ichioka Shiun saku with seal Shiun. 14cm (5½in) high. (3).
